Output 39c11e789880556f4870084053585f6a578e6659b9c246bef075d3d08b66fd8a:16

value
99622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 274a593c79b879fff7b95cae3acb6e5c951c483d OP_EQUAL
address
35GmLrYPRpXB5yDrcNESfYEWEQWBC2xBJW
transaction
39c11e789880556f4870084053585f6a578e6659b9c246bef075d3d08b66fd8a
confirmations
168337
spent
true